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Way of the Buddha The object of this little book is to give the reader a succinct account of an Eastern sage whose doctrine of the Path has been accepted by millions of the human race, and whose influ ence is still felt at the ends of the earth. What is generally understood by Buddhism will be found to differ greatly from the way of emancipation here set forth. And for this reason Unlike all other religions, Buddhism began with out God and without prayer, and ended in be coming a most elaborate system of polytheism with a superstitious multiplication of collects. Up to the time of Asoka, about 250 b.o., it seems to have remained comparatively pure; but by the thirteenth century a.d., when the revival of Brahmanism drove it from India, it had assumed in other countries so many new features as to be hardly recognisable. Nor should this be a matter for great surprise. When an essentially Aryan religion or system of philosophy is transplanted to Turanian lands it is not to be expected that it will remain unchanged. The contrast between the teaching of the Christ and of His apostles, and the Christianity of Rome in the Middle Ages is indeed great, but the difference between the Buddhism of Tibet and the Dharma of Sakya Muni 1s greater still. The history of the faith In all the lands m which it has taken root is far too vast a subject for our present purpose, but a general outline of its rise and fall in Aryavarta. Between east and west, says the author, a gulf has been fixed, a gulf created by basic ideas, hollowed out by the erosive action of speculative thought. The Western mind takes for granted the reality of outward things. The Eastern mind attributes the only reality to the soul. All else is maya, illusion. And there are very few that can bridge thatgulf.In the East, where the soul is the supreme and fundamental reality, the identification of God with the world-soul, or soul of universal Mature, is the outcome of a movement of thought which is at once natural and logical. This divine soul is the only real existence: by comparison with it all outward things are shadows, and all inward things, so far as they hold aloof from the all-embracing consciousness, are dreams. The worship of the supernatural, such as is to be found in Christianity, often ends in the despiritualization of Nature. which becomes merely the world without and therefore opposed to the Supernatural, which becomes the dwelling place of God .

Book excerpt: Excerpt from Buddha: His Life, His Doctrine, His Order The history of the Buddhist faith begins with a band of mendicant monks who gathered round the person of Gotama, the Buddha, in the country bordering on the Ganges, about five hundred years before the commencement of the Christian era. What bound them together and gave a stamp to their simple and earnest world of thought, was the deeply felt and clearly and sternly expressed consciousness, that all earthly existence is full of sorrow, and that the only deliverance from sorrow is in renunciation of the world and eternal rest. An itinerant teacher and his itinerant followers, not unlike those bands, who in later times bore through Galilee the tidings: the kingdom of heaven is at hand, went through the realms of India with the burden of sorrow and death, and the announcement: open ye your ears; the deliverance from death is found.
